Basically it’s metformin, GLP-1, SGLT-2, would be the … WebAug 12, 2024 · Metformin is the most common medication used to treat type 2 diabetes. It's sometimes used to treat type 1 diabetes in people who still have some insulin production, along with insulin. Metformin helps control blood sugar by making it easier for the body to absorb glucose. It's usually taken twice a day, with meals. coming soon dvd blu ray https://smajanitorial.com
